Over 450 people across country waiting on a bed in Emergency Departments

Emergency Departments in Hospitals around the country are experiencing severe overcrowding today.

Figures from the Irish Nurses and Midwives Organisation show over 450 people are waiting on trolleys for admission this lunchtime.

Cork University Hospital has 33 people receiving treatment on trolleys and the Mercy University Hospital has 23 patients waiting on a bed.

The INMO says the most overcrowding in the country is at University Hospital Limerick where 54 people are on trolleys and chairs.
